THE ROLE To assist clinicians in the administrative tasks required for clinical care. To facilitate the admin process of gathering information from different services as required. Completing and submitting documents on behalf of the GP and other clinicians. To be a point of contact for fellow health professionals including nursing and residential homes, social services, ambulance, hospitals, CMHT, key workers and community services.

To be the first point of contact in the event of patient death. Liaising with the family, funeral directors, and coroner, if required. To ensure paperwork is processed in a timely manner and families are supported through the process. To liaise with the Integrated Urgent Care Hub based at St Albans City hospital.

Work with the GP team to identify patients that need to be seen face to face and ensure a timely referral is made to their service. To produce community and mental health referrals for patients as appropriate. Assist in the completion and submission of safeguarding paperwork. To complete fit notes where clinically appropriate Checking blood pressure results submitted by patients, calculating averages, and assessing against clinical guidelines alerting clinicians where readings are out of tolerance.

Support clinicians in requesting laboratory tests to monitor ongoing conditions and medications. Action patient tasks and ensure prompt turnaround as per surgery protocol. Chase up hospital appointments, results and other queries as required by clinicians. Compiling chargeable To whom it may concern letters requested by patients.

Manage the Surgery website queries, referring on to appropriate department or dealing with queries. To undertake any other reasonable work when requested to do so by clinicians and the Practice Business Manager
